Información que a Marisa K. le gustaría saber sobre tu mascota
Some questions I have: 1. Any allergies? 2. Health conditions? 3. Reactive to certain animals, people, sounds and other environments? 4. Training methods? 5. Commands used? 6. On any medications? 7. Specific diet? 8. Type of collar and leash? 9. Doesn't like certain areas touched? (For example, the ears) 10. Will your pet try to escape indoors or outdoors? 11. Any special needs?
